The seeds are often blended with warm jaggery, sugar, or palm sugar and made into balls that are eaten as a snack.In Manipur, black sesame is used for the preparation of Thoiding and Singju (a kind of salad).Thoiding is prepared with ginger, chilli and vegetables and is served along with the spicy Singju dish.

Black or white, it’s completely safe and healthy to eat raw sesame seeds, though you might find the taste a little stronger and more bitter.
